Munich serves as a dynamic nexus for German-language performing arts, housing institutions like the Residenztheater, Bayerische Staatsoper, and Münchner Kammerspiele. The city attracts over 10 million annual visitors to its cultural venues, creating consistent demand for skilled performers. Recent industry reports indicate a 22% growth in regional film productions since 2021, with Munich acting as a primary filming location for both German and international projects. However, the market remains highly competitive with approximately 3,500 registered actors competing for roles. The Actor must differentiate through specialized skills (e.g., bilingual English-German proficiency) and strategic networking to stand out in Germany Munich's discerning industry circles.
